NearIQ MCP Server
Connects NearIQ competitive intelligence to AI tools like Claude Desktop, Claude Code, Cursor, and Windsurf, enabling queries about competitors, reviews, rank tracking, and more.
README
@neariq/mcp-server
Connect NearIQ competitive intelligence to Claude Desktop, Claude Code, Cursor, Windsurf, and other Model Context Protocol clients.
- npm package:
@neariq/mcp-server - Source: https://github.com/NearIQ/mcp-server
- Docs: https://docs.neariq.io/guides/mcp-server
- Requires: Node.js 18+ and a NearIQ Growth+ API key
What It Does
The NearIQ MCP server lets AI tools query your competitive intelligence through NearIQ's public v1 API. It exposes tools for your business profile, competitors, reviews, rank tracking, citations, AI visibility, market intelligence, content, alerts, reports, and AI chat.
The server runs locally over stdio. It does not store your API key; your MCP client passes the key through the NEARIQ_API_KEY environment variable at runtime.
Install
Most MCP clients can run the package directly with npx, so you usually do not need a global install:
npx -y @neariq/mcp-server
If you want to test the package manually:
NEARIQ_API_KEY=niq_live_your_key_here npx -y @neariq/mcp-server
Get A NearIQ API Key
- Sign in to NearIQ.
- Open Settings > API Keys.
- Create an API key with the scopes your MCP client should use.
- Copy the key into your MCP client configuration as
NEARIQ_API_KEY.
Configure Your MCP Client
Claude Desktop
Add this to claude_desktop_config.json:
{
"mcpServers": {
"neariq": {
"command": "npx",
"args": ["-y", "@neariq/mcp-server"],
"env": {
"NEARIQ_API_KEY": "niq_live_your_key_here"
}
}
}
}
Claude Code
Add this to your .mcp.json:
{
"mcpServers": {
"neariq": {
"command": "npx",
"args": ["-y", "@neariq/mcp-server"],
"env": {
"NEARIQ_API_KEY": "niq_live_your_key_here"
}
}
}
}
Cursor
Add this to .cursor/mcp.json:
{
"mcpServers": {
"neariq": {
"command": "npx",
"args": ["-y", "@neariq/mcp-server"],
"env": {
"NEARIQ_API_KEY": "niq_live_your_key_here"
}
}
}
}
Windsurf
Add this to your Windsurf MCP settings:
{
"mcpServers": {
"neariq": {
"command": "npx",
"args": ["-y", "@neariq/mcp-server"],
"env": {
"NEARIQ_API_KEY": "niq_live_your_key_here"
}
}
}
}
Environment Variables
| Variable | Required | Description |
|---|---|---|
NEARIQ_API_KEY |
Yes | NearIQ API key, usually starting with niq_live_. |
NEARIQ_BASE_URL |
No | API base URL. Defaults to https://app.neariq.io. |
Available Tools
| Tool | Description |
|---|---|
get_business_profile |
Your business profile, rating, and plan. |
get_business_details |
Address, phone, website, hours, and profile health. |
list_competitors |
Tracked competitors with health, momentum, and financial signals. |
get_competitor_detail |
Deep detail for one competitor. |
add_competitor |
Add a competitor by place ID or manual details. |
search_businesses |
Search businesses before adding a competitor. |
get_reviews |
Your reviews or a competitor's reviews. |
get_gap_analysis |
AI gap analysis against competitors. |
get_ai_visibility |
AI search visibility scores and recommendations. |
get_rank_checks |
Local search rank tracking results. |
get_citations |
NAP consistency and citation health. |
get_market_leaderboard |
Market leaderboard by rating, reviews, health, or velocity. |
generate_content |
Generate posts, FAQs, review templates, outlines, and more. |
list_content |
Previously generated content. |
get_alerts |
Business alerts and recommendations. |
get_behavioral_signals |
Engagement benchmarks and signal grades. |
generate_report |
AI intelligence report generation. |
list_reports |
Previously generated reports. |
ask_neariq |
Ask NearIQ AI about your business and market data. |
get_keyword_suggestions |
AI keyword suggestions for local SEO. |
Example Prompts
What are my top three competitors doing better than me?
Generate a Google Business Profile post about our summer promotion.
How visible is my business in AI search, and what should I fix first?
Troubleshooting
NEARIQ_API_KEY environment variable is required
Your MCP client did not pass the API key into the server process. Recheck the env block in your client configuration and restart the client.
API 401 Or 403
Confirm the key is active, belongs to the right NearIQ workspace, and has the scopes required by the tool you are calling. API access requires a plan that includes NearIQ API usage.
Tools Do Not Appear
Restart your MCP client after editing the configuration. If your client supports remote MCP servers, you can also use the hosted endpoint documented at https://docs.neariq.io/guides/mcp-server.
Development
npm install
npm run build
The package source currently lives in the NearIQ monorepo and is mirrored to the public distribution repository.
License
MIT
Recommended Servers
playwright-mcp
A Model Context Protocol server that enables LLMs to interact with web pages through structured accessibility snapshots without requiring vision models or screenshots.
Magic Component Platform (MCP)
An AI-powered tool that generates modern UI components from natural language descriptions, integrating with popular IDEs to streamline UI development workflow.
Audiense Insights MCP Server
Enables interaction with Audiense Insights accounts via the Model Context Protocol, facilitating the extraction and analysis of marketing insights and audience data including demographics, behavior, and influencer engagement.
VeyraX MCP
Single MCP tool to connect all your favorite tools: Gmail, Calendar and 40 more.
graphlit-mcp-server
The Model Context Protocol (MCP) Server enables integration between MCP clients and the Graphlit service. Ingest anything from Slack to Gmail to podcast feeds, in addition to web crawling, into a Graphlit project - and then retrieve relevant contents from the MCP client.
Kagi MCP Server
An MCP server that integrates Kagi search capabilities with Claude AI, enabling Claude to perform real-time web searches when answering questions that require up-to-date information.
E2B
Using MCP to run code via e2b.
Neon Database
MCP server for interacting with Neon Management API and databases
Exa Search
A Model Context Protocol (MCP) server lets AI assistants like Claude use the Exa AI Search API for web searches. This setup allows AI models to get real-time web information in a safe and controlled way.
Qdrant Server
This repository is an example of how to create a MCP server for Qdrant, a vector search engine.